    What's special

    156 East 79th Street on Manhattan's Upper East Side: Elegant prewar 2 bedroom with 10' ceilings, originally 8 rooms, approximately 2100 square feet. A 15' gallery leads to the large living room with wood-burning fireplace and 3 windows facing north over the double width of 79th Street. An inviting and beautiful library which was once the formal dining room is adjacent to the living room. The 18' x 23' kitchen/dining room can seat 8, has top-quality appliances, beautiful wood cabinets, a washer and dryer and a powder room. The comfortable primary bedroom has a large private dressing room with extensive closet space and 2 beautiful renovated baths. A second bedroom is on the hallway. Central air conditioning throughout. This spacious and sophisticated apartment is in a prime location with easy access to transportation, shopping, restaurants, museums, galleries and Central Park. 156 East 79th Street was designed by Schwartz & Gross and built in 1917. It is a well-established coop with full-time doormen and a live-in resident manager. There is individual basement storage ($600 per year), a laundry room and bicycle storage. Pets are permitted. Flip tax $1,000. The coop has recently replaced the passenger and service elevators, has fully renovated the lobby and has completed Local Law 11 work.
